What we do
We curate transformative learning experiences like discernment academies, church planter assessments, co-creator trainings, and more.
We co-create an imagination for faith-based start ups by tracking national trends, putting planters from across the country in conversation with each other, and practicing humility in our willingness to always be surprised by where God is leading next.
We connect innovators with systems of support by seeking culturally-informed support plans for planters, connecting planters with each other, and offering tailored content.
How we understand gospel liberation
Post-Colonial
We repent of America’s history of colonization. We compost colonizer mindsets (present in many church planter trainings) into insistence on liberation.
Contextual
There is no generic church planting method. Everything has arisen out of context and, therefore, all of our methods must be adaptive to context.
Innovative
We’re not afraid of new things! In fact, Intersect was founded by practitioners, by people who saw gaps in our contexts and created something new to fill it.
Diverse
We believe it honors the Gospel when we create space for many experiences, backgrounds, and perspectives. Further, we know that significant harm can happen in these spaces unless there is a thorough and honest power analysis of privilege and marginalization.
